## What is Sight Reader?

Sight Reader helps you get faster at reading sheet music, one round at a time.
Practice reading single notes or triads on treble and bass clef, then answer before the timer runs out. Each round gives you instant feedback, a simple score, and a review of what you missed so you can build real recognition instead of guessing.
Whether you’re new to piano, brushing up on music theory, or trying to make note names feel automatic, Sight Reader keeps practice focused and lightweight.
Features:
Treble and bass clef practice
Single-note and chord recognition
Accidentals, major, minor, diminished, and augmented triads
Timed rounds with instant feedback
Review cards for missed answers
Progress tracking for notes and chords
Piano-style audio playback
Free to use.
Sight reading gets easier when you practice often. Sight Reader makes those little practice sessions simple to start and easy to repeat.
